Nicholas Kreines, David P. Ryan, Liberty Mineral Partners LLC, Nak Resources INC., and CGR Oil and Gas, LLC v. ES3 Minerals, LLC

Kreines v. ES3 Minerals · Texas Court of Appeals, 15th District · December 4, 2025 · No. 15-25-00027-CV

Summary

The document concerns an appellate challenge arising from a case transferred to the Texas Business Court, including whether the transferee court must independently reconsider or adopt prior orders. The separate opinion discusses the temporary injunction, bond, and the expedited resolution of those issues through trial on the merits.

Questions Presented

  1. Whether the appellate court could decline to review issues because the parties did not raise objections to the prior orders again after the case was transferred to the Business Court.
  2. Whether the transferred-case court was required to adopt or separately reconsider prior orders entered by another judge.
  3. Whether the appellate court should instruct the Business Court to conduct an evidentiary hearing regarding the temporary-injunction bond and to consider adopting the prior judge's reasoning.
